Erica Jordan (Smith) Dettmar, age 25, of Vandalia, walked into the arms of Jesus on Saturday, November 22, 2025, at 9:44 a.m. Erica was born on May 4th, 2000 in Sturgis, the daughter of John & Rebecca (Huffman) Smith. Erica graduated from Constantine High School in 2019. On October 5th, 2025, she married the love of her life, Isaiah Dettmar in Marcellus.
Erica was loved by all who knew her. She lit up every room she walked into with her sweet gentle spirit and kind heart. She worked as a teacher at Country Kids Preschool & Daycare for seven years where she invested so much of herself into each and every child. She loved and cared for her babies with a depth of love usually only found in one’s mother. She holds a special place in the hearts of all her students. In her free time, Erica loved to go four-wheeling, watch fireworks, decorate, visit the zoo, and party plan. She enjoyed trips to Florida to visit her grandma (Virgina Stump), Gatorland, and Sea World. She loved celebrating the holidays and shopping at the store or online. She was very fond of sweets, especially Crumbl Cookies and ice cream. She loved animals, especially her adorable dog, Toby.
Left to treasure her memory are her husband Isaiah Dettmar, Vandalia; parents John & Rebecca Smith, Constantine, brother Aaron (Libny) Smith; Elkhart, and Grandmother Virginia Stump, Leesburg, Florida. As well as many other family and friends.
Erica’s celebration of life will be on Saturday, November 29, 2025, from 11am to 1pm at Eley Funeral Home in Constantine. Religious services will follow at 1:00 with Pastor Jamey Smith of Restoration Church officiating. Internment will be at Constantine Township Cemetery.
